“Progressive” Group Posing as Tea Party Lobbying Against School Choice

Tom Murse recently investigated the group behind the “NoVoucherTax” web, radio and TV ads. While the ads convey an anti-tax message, mimicking a Tea Party group, the group responsible is really a combination of Democrat party consultants and “progressives.”

The website domain NoVoucherTax.org had been registered to Baltimore-based Democratic media strategist Walter Ludwig and his firm TeamBlue Politics Inc., which does work in Washington. Its owner is now mysteriously listed as “H H.”  …

The only trace of the group in state records is its rather vague registration with the Department of State. NoVoucherTax.org is a new lobbying organization, but it exploits exemptions in the disclosure laws to keep its identity secret.

It does list an employee: Harlan Hill, outreach specialist.

The NoVoucherTax.org is hosted on a Coraloo Studio domain; the South Carolina firm does web design and new media management for Democratic political campaigns and initiatives. Hill is the firm’s proprietor.

What’s the group up to now?  One of my colleagues passed along the alert below, in which NoVoucherTax targets primarily Republican lawmakers, asking people who don’t even live in their district to make calls to specific legislators.
